#435226 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#435226 is composed of 26.3% red, 32.2%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.7% yellow and 67.8% black. It has a hue angle of 80.5 degrees, a saturation of 36.7% and a lightness of 23.5%. #435226 color hex could be obtained by blending #86a44c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#435226 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#435226 has RGB values of R:67, G:82, B:38 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0, Y:0.54, K:0.68. Its decimal value is 4411942.
